Living Memories group, Narberth RFC – Pembrokeshire – Case study – The THRIVE project 2025
Frank Farrer of 5 Animal Frolics Tai Chi and Qigong, Neyland delivered 2 fully funded Qi Gong sessions at the Living Memory group, Narberth Rugby Club on 23rd of January 2025, as part of the Thrive project wellness activities. The Living Memory group is for people in the community who have become socially isolated and lonely because of health reasons.
Mary Adams, who co-ordinates the Living Memory group, promoted the sessions locally, signing up regulars and visitors to engage with the THRIVE project by attending this free wellbeing event. Mary said “What a fabulous afternoon doing Qi Gong with the Living Memory Group and the Narberth school children. Great fun.”
A member of staff from the school said “Thank you Mary for a fabulous afternoon, the children thoroughly enjoyed learning Qigong. It is such a powerful way for school children to connect with the Living Memory group and develop a sense of community. They were all chatting with each other saying how much fun it was today. Thanks again for the opportunity”.

What is Qigong?
Pronounced “chi gong,” it was developed in China thousands of years ago as part of traditional Chinese medicine. It involves using exercises to optimise energy within the body, mind, and spirit, with the goal of improving and maintaining health and well-being. Qigong has both psychological and physical components and involves the regulation of the mind, breath, and body’s movement and posture.
Qigong is a gentle system of breathing exercises, body postures and movements, promoting mental well-being, concentration, maintaining good health and enhancing the flow of vital energy. It involves very simple repetitive exercises, so it is suitable for everyone. It can reduce symptoms of depression and anxiety, improve mood, increase energy, reduce symptoms of chronic fatigue and enhance immune function.
